WILD POLLY looked to have a bit in hand at Ayr and is taken to defy her penalty. Southern Girl has been knocking on the door in similar events and ought to be thereabouts again, while Blue Hawaii won a Musselburgh bumper last month and her pedigree suggests she'll be seen in an even better light now hurdling over further.
